Herbalife appoints first Filipino to its nutrition board

Dr. Francis Gregory Samonte

SAN FRANCISCO–Global nutrition company Herbalife appointed Dr. Francis Gregory Samonte, an expert in pediatric neurology, to its Nutrition Advisory Board (NAB), effective January 1.

Samonte is the first Filipino appointed to the NAB, which is composed of leading experts from around the world in the fields of nutrition and health. They inform, educate and train independent Herbalife members on the principles of nutrition, physical activity and healthy lifestyle.

Samonte’s appointment boosts the number of NAB members to 30 and reflects efforts to further bolster in public awareness and educational programs on balanced nutrition and healthy active lifestyle in 15 countries as part of Herbalife’s Asia Pacific Wellness Tour initiative.

Samonte is among the Philippines’ premier experts in pediatric neurology and is currently based in Manila. He graduated from De La Salle University College of Medicine in 1995, and has since studied at institutes including John Hopkins University and Harvard Medical School. He was a recipient of the Chairman’s Achievement Award, Department of Pediatrics, University of Louisville, Kentucky, and his affiliations include the Philippines Medical Association.

Samonte is active in supporting charities, notably as a member of the Board of Directors of Community Based Resources in Zambales.
